Two steam hauled excursions from a very dull and grey weekend.

Saturday saw ex. LMS Jubilee No. 5690 "Leander" with the Hellifield to Carlisle and Carnforth "Cumbrian Fellsman".
4286b.jpg


Sunday was "The Tin Bath Extra" (ignore the headboard) from Manchester to Sheffield, Barnsley, Huddersfield Blackburn and Manchester.

This was a double header of "Black 5's" 45407 "The Lancashire Fusilier" and 45231 "The Sherwood Forester".
